ARIZONA 85281 DEPARTMENT OF ENGLISH GRADUATE SCHOLARSHIPS AND ASSISTANTSHIPS A number of scholarships and Teaching Assistantships and Associateships are available at Arizona State University for the academic year 1981-1982. Graduate Tuition Scholarships waive the out-of-state tuition and Graduate Academic Scholarships waive the in-state fees. A limited number of Graduate Fellowships is available. These carry waiver of all tuition and fees and a stipend of $5.000.00. Teaching Assistantships (MA level) carry waiver of out-of-state tuition and a stipend of $5,700.00. Teaching Associateships (PhD level) carry waiver of out-of-state tuition and a stipend of $6,100.00 [this stipend becomes $6,500 at the ABD stage!. Teaching Assistants and Associates are expected to teach two sections of freshman composition each semester and to enroll in at least two graduate courses each semester. Teaching Assistants and Associates with teaching experience elsewhere or after several semesters at ASU may be eligible for assignment as Research Assistants to the editor of ENGLISH LITERATURE IN TRANSITION. Such appointments may be on a quarter- or half-time basis (10 or 20 hours per week).
